How our sorting works

The order in which job vacancies are displayed is determined by a composite score based on the following factors:

  • Keyword Relevance: How well your search terms match the vacancy details. We prioritize matches found in the job title, followed by job requirements, location names, and educational levels. Matches within general employer information or the organization's name carry a lower weight.
  • Commercial Prioritization (Premium Jobs): Vacancies paid for by employers ('Premium' or 'Sponsored') receive a ranking boost and will appear higher in the search results.
  • Recency (Date Relevance): Newer vacancies are prioritized. The relevance score of a vacancy is reduced by half once the posting is older than 30 days.
  • Proximity (Distance Relevance): Vacancies located closer to your search location are ranked higher. For vacancies located more than 30 km from the search center, the relevance score is halved.
The final ranking is established by multiplying all these individual factors to calculate the total relevance score.

    Skilled Telehandler Operator | Durham
    Agency: Search Consultancy
    Location: Durham
    Search Consultancy is looking for an experienced and reliable Telehandler Operator to join a busy construction site in Durham. We are partnering with a leading contractor who requires a safety-conscious operator to manage site logistics and material distribution.
    If you are a precise operator who can work efficiently to support various trades on-site, we have an immediate start available now.

    The Role
    This is a key role in maintaining the flow of the site. You will be responsible for:
    * Material Distribution: Loading and unloading deliveries and distributing materials to various work areas and scaffolding levels.
    * Site Logistics: Assisting the Site Manager with organizing the storage area and ensuring the site remains clear and accessible.
    * Safety & Maintenance: Carrying out daily vehicle checks, reporting any defects, and ensuring the machine is operated safely in accordance with site rules.
    * Trade Support: Working closely with bricklayers, joiners, and groundworkers to ensure they have the supplies needed to stay productive.
    Requirements
    * NVQ Qualification: Must hold a UK NVQ Level 2 in Plant Operations (Telescopic Handler).
    * CSCS/CPCS/NPORS Card: A valid Blue Card (CPCS or NPORS with CSCS logo) is mandatory.
    * Experience: Proven track record operating a Telehandler on busy residential or commercial sites.
    * Reliability: Punctuality and a strong work ethic are essential for this role.
    * PPE: Standard 5-point PPE required at all times.
    * Right to Work: Must have a valid right to work in the UK.
